    Abstract:

    Based on the “integrated construction and management” model, the TB Power Station has established a green intelligent construction system that covers all aspects, full flows, full processes, and the entire lifecycle. By implementing intelligent construction during the construction phase, such as smart dam construction, smart powerhouse construction, green and intelligent sand and gravel processing, and intelligent electromechanical installation, as well as business management systems covering various aspects of engineering construction involving safety, quality, environmental and water and soil conservation, progress, materials, equipment, contracts, and digital archives, it has addressed issues related to processes, techniques, and performance management across multiple stages, disciplines, and performance entities. The application of these systems has achieved favorable results in engineering practice, marking a transition from the traditional construction management model to the intelligent construction management model.
